Understanding the CPF Retirement System
Singapore’s Central Provident Fund is a national savings scheme designed to support citizens and permanent residents throughout different stages of life. CPF contributions are made monthly by both employees and employers, creating a structured savings system that grows over time.
CPF savings are divided into three main accounts: the Ordinary Account (OA), the Special Account (SA), and the MediSave Account (MA). Each account serves a specific financial purpose within the CPF framework.
The Ordinary Account is commonly used for housing purchases, education expenses, and investments. The Special Account focuses on retirement savings and typically earns higher interest rates. The MediSave Account is designed to help individuals manage healthcare expenses and insurance costs.
When CPF members reach retirement age, savings from the Ordinary and Special Accounts are transferred into the Retirement Account (RA). The RA becomes the primary source of funds used to generate monthly retirement income through CPF LIFE payouts.

What Is CPF LIFE?
CPF LIFE stands for Lifelong Income For the Elderly. It is Singapore’s national annuity scheme that converts CPF retirement savings into lifelong monthly payouts.
Instead of withdrawing CPF savings as a lump sum, CPF LIFE provides retirees with regular monthly income that continues for the rest of their lives. This system helps ensure that retirees do not run out of money during retirement.
CPF LIFE payouts generally start at age 65, although CPF members can delay payouts until age 70. Delaying payouts allows CPF balances to earn additional interest, which increases the eventual monthly retirement income.
Factors That Determine Your CPF LIFE Payout
Several factors influence how much CPF LIFE payout you will receive. The most important factor is the size of your Retirement Account balance. Larger CPF balances typically generate higher monthly payouts because more funds are available to support retirement income.
Another important factor is the retirement sum level. CPF members may set aside the Basic Retirement Sum, Full Retirement Sum, or Enhanced Retirement Sum. Higher retirement sums generally produce higher CPF LIFE payouts.
The CPF LIFE plan selected also affects monthly income. Each plan offers a different payout structure designed to suit different retirement preferences.

What is CPF LIFE in Singapore?
CPF LIFE stands for Lifelong Income For the Elderly. It is Singapore’s national annuity scheme designed to provide lifelong monthly payouts to CPF members starting from retirement age. The scheme ensures retirees receive a steady stream of income for as long as they live.
When do CPF LIFE payouts start?
CPF LIFE payouts usually begin at age 65. However, CPF members can choose to delay payouts up to age 70. Delaying payouts allows CPF savings to continue earning interest, which can result in higher monthly payouts later.
How are CPF LIFE monthly payouts calculated?
CPF LIFE payouts are calculated based on several factors including your Retirement Account balance, the CPF LIFE plan selected, the payout start age, and CPF interest earned before retirement. These variables determine the estimated monthly income you may receive.
What are the CPF LIFE plan options?
CPF LIFE offers three main plans: the Standard Plan, Basic Plan, and Escalating Plan. The Standard Plan provides higher monthly payouts, the Basic Plan provides slightly lower payouts with more savings preserved, and the Escalating Plan starts with lower payouts but increases payouts each year.

Can CPF LIFE payouts last for life?
Yes. CPF LIFE is specifically designed to provide lifelong monthly payouts. Even if your CPF savings are fully used, payouts will continue for as long as you live under the CPF LIFE scheme.
